X.803 (1994 E) Summary This Recommendation I International Standard describes the selection, placement and use of security services and mechanisms in the upper layers (applications, presen
20、tation and session layers) of the OS1 Reference Model. Introduction The OS1 Security Architecture (CCITT Rec. X.800 I IS0 7498-2) defines the security-related architectural elements which are appropriate for application when security protection is required in an open systems environment. This Recomm
21、endation I International Standard describes the selection, placement, and use of security services and mechanisms in the upper layers (Application, Presentation, and Session Iayers) of the OS1 Reference Model. .
